Add 12/10 and 4/60
1st number: 1 2/10, 2nd number: 4/60
12/10 + 4/60 is 19/15.
Steps for adding fractions
-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
LCM of 10 and 60 is 60
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 60 - For the 1st fraction, since 10 × 6 = 60,
12/10 = 12 × 6/10 × 6 = 72/60 -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 60 × 1 = 60,
4/60 = 4 × 1/60 × 1 = 4/60 - Add the two like fractions:
72/60 + 4/60 = 72 + 4/60 = 76/60 - 76/60 simplified gives 19/15
- So, 12/10 + 4/60 = 19/15
